トップ「Angularjs」の質問

オープンソースのJavaScriptフレームワークであるAngularJS(1.x)に関する質問に使用します。

AngularJSテンプレートのifelseステートメント

AngularJSテンプレートで条件を実行したい。 YoutubeAPIから動画リストを取得します。 一部のビデオは16:9の比率であり、一部は4:3の比率です。私はこのような条件を作りたいです:if video.yt$aspectRatio equals widescreen then element's […] 続きを読む…

if-statement angularjs

AngularJSで$ scope。$ watchと$ scope。$ applyを使用するにはどうすればよいですか?

$scope.$watchと$scope.$apply使い方がわかりません。 公式ドキュメントは役に立ちません。私が具体的に理解していないこと:それらはDOMに接続されていますか?モデルに対するDOMの変更を更新するにはどうすればよいですか?それらの間の接続ポイントは何ですか?このチュートリアルを試しましたが、当然のことながら$watchと$applyを理解する必要があります。$applyと$watchは何をしますか、そしてそれらを適切に使用するにはどうすればよいですか?

angularjs angularjs-scope

AngularJSngClass条件付き

ng-classような式を条件付きにする方法はありますか?たとえば、私は次のことを試しました。<span ng-class="{test: 'obj.value1 == \'someothervalue\''}"> […] 続きを読む…

html css angularjs

jQueryのバックグラウンドがある場合、「AngularJSで考える」ですか?

jQueryでのクライアント側アプリケーションの開発に精通していると仮定しますが、ここでAngularJSの使用を開始したいと思います。 必要なパラダイムシフトについて説明していただけますか? 答えを組み立てるのに役立つかもしれないいくつかの質問があります:クライアント側のWebアプリケーションを異なる方法で設計および設計するにはどうすればよいですか? 最大の違いは何ですか?何をする/使用するのをやめるべきですか。 代わりに何を始めるべきですか?サーバー側の考慮事項/制限はありますか?jQueryとAngularJS詳細な比較は探していません。

javascript jquery angularjs

ng-repeat:単一フィールドでフィルタリング

ng-repeatを使用して繰り返し使用している一連の製品があり、<div ng-repeat="product in products | filter:by_colour"& […] 続きを読む…

angularjs ng-repeat angularjs-filter

AngularJSを使用したファイルのアップロード

これが私のHTMLフォームです:<form name="myForm" ng-submit=""> <input ng-model= […] 続きを読む…

angularjs angularjs-fileupload

クラスを条件付きで適用するための最良の方法は何ですか?

ulでレンダリングされ、各要素にliがあり、コントローラーにselectedIndexというプロパティがある配列があるとします。 AngularJSのインデックスselectedIndexでliクラスを追加する最良の方法は何でしょうか?現在、 liコードを(手動で)複製し、クラスをliタグの1つに追加し、 ng-showとng-hideを使用して1つだけを表示していますインデックスごとに […] 続きを読む…

css angularjs

ページの読み込み時にAngularJSコントローラー関数を実行するにはどうすればよいですか?

現在、検索と結果の表示を可能にするAngular.jsページがあります。 ユーザーが検索結果をクリックしてから、戻るボタンをクリックします。 検索結果を再度表示したいのですが、検索をトリガーして実行する方法がわかりません。 詳細は次のとおりです。私のAngular.jsページは、検索フィールドと検索ボタンを備えた検索ページです。 ユーザーは手動でクエリを入力してボタンを押すと、ajaxクエリが実行され、結果が表示されます。 検索語でURLを更新します。 それはすべてうまくいきます。ユーザーが検索結果をクリックすると、別のページに移動します。これも問題なく機能します。ユーザーが[戻る]ボタンをクリックして角度検索ページに戻ると、検索語を含む正しいURLが表示されます。 すべて正常に動作します。検索フィールドの値をURLの検索語にバインドしたので、予想される検索語が含まれています。 すべて正常に動作します。ユーザーが「検索ボタン」を押さなくても、検索機能を再度実行するにはどうすればよいですか? jqueryの場合は、documentready関数で関数を実行します。 […] 続きを読む…

angularjs onload

'X-Frame-Options'を 'SAMEORIGIN'に設定したため、フレームへの表示を拒否しました

私は、人々が自分の携帯電話からアクセスできるように、応答性の高いWebサイトを開発しています。 このサイトには、Google、Facebookなど(OAuth)を使用してログインできる安全なパーツがいくつかあります。サーバーバックエンドはASP.NetWeb API 2を使用して開発されており、フロントエンドは主にAngularJSと一部のRazorです。認証部分については、Androidを含むすべてのブラウザですべて正常に機能していますが、 […] 続きを読む…

angularjs asp.net-web-api google-oauth